function toggleRestaurantDropdown() {
	if($("#rest-sel-body").hasClass("active")) {
		$("#rest-sel-body").removeClass("active");
	} else {
		$("#rest-sel-body").addClass("active");
	}
}

function changeRestaurant(id) {
	if($("input[name='reservation[timeclicked]']").attr("value") == 1) {
		$("input[name='reservation[time]']").removeClass("beforeclicked");
	}
	if($("input[name='reservation[dateclicked]']").attr("value") == 1) {
		$("input[name='reservation[day]']").removeClass("beforeclicked");
	}
	if(id == 0) {
		return;
	}

	$("#rest-sel-body").removeClass("active");
	$("#restaurant-selector-current").html($("#r-"+id).html());
	for(var i = 0; i < 7; i++) {
		$("#i-"+i).removeClass("active");
		$("#address-"+i).removeClass("active");
	}
	$("#i-"+id).addClass("active");
	$("#address-"+id).addClass("active");
	
	$("input[name='reservation[restaurantname]']").attr("value",$("#r-"+id).html());
	$("input[name='reservation[restaurantid]']").attr("value",id);
	
	switch(parseInt(id)) {
		case 1:
			$("input[name='reservation[recipient]']").val("wollzeile@plachutta.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ungWollzeile@more.or.at");
			break;
		case 2:
			$("input[name='reservation[recipient]']").val("hietzing@plachutta.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ungHietzing@more.or.at");
			break;
		case 3:
			$("input[name='reservation[recipient]']").val("nussdorf@plachutta.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ungNussdorf@more.or.at");
			break;
		case 4:
			$("input[name='reservation[recipient]']").val("office@gruenspan.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ungGruenspan@more.or.at");
			break;
		case 5:
			$("input[name='reservation[recipient]']").val("office@mario-hietzing.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ungMarios@more.or.at");
			break;
		case 6:
			$("input[name='reservation[recipient]']").val("oper@plachutta.at");
			//$("input[name='reservation[recipient]']").attr("value","ReservierungWalfischgasse@more.or.at");
			break;
	}
}

function toggleSmokingDropdown() {
	if($("#form-sel-body").hasClass("active")) {
		$("#form-sel-body").removeClass("active");
	} else {
		$("#form-sel-body").addClass("active");
	}
}

function changeSmokingarea(id) {
	var smoking = id == 1 ? "Nichtraucher" : "Raucher";
	$("#form-sel-body").removeClass("active");
	$("#form-selector-current").html($("#o-"+id).html());
	$("input[name='reservation[smokingarea]']").attr("value",smoking);
}

function dateInputClicked() {
	if($("input[name='reservation[dateclicked]']").attr("value") == 0) {
		$("input[name='reservation[day]']").attr("value", "");
		$("input[name='reservation[day]']").removeClass("beforeclicked");
		$("input[name='reservation[dateclicked]']").attr("value","1");
	}
}

function timeInputClicked() {
	if($("input[name='reservation[timeclicked]']").attr("value") == 0) {
		$("input[name='reservation[time]']").attr("value", "");
		$("input[name='reservation[time]']").removeClass("beforeclicked");
		$("input[name='reservation[timeclicked]']").attr("value","1");
	}
}
